Brittany McDonald co-writes and co-produces all of her own music, and is currently unsigned and unpublished. Her smash, Another Wanna Be, is on the Sony Walkman on over 8 million units worldwide, distributed through Best Buy and Wal-Mart. She has co-produced her independent music video for Another Wanna Be, has songs featured on Guiding Light, and a pending commercial placement.
